During a recent conversation with a startup, we learned that while many early-stage companies might not focus on cost allocation yet—observability remains a top priority. Understanding how resources are being used—whether it’s for scaling or optimization—is critical for these fast-growing businesses. Cloud asset management is a great use case here. By gaining full visibility into their cloud assets, startups can eliminate unused or underutilized resources, optimizing their spend and performance.
